Where this album fits

Career context
Released in 2004, 'Dimanche à Bamako' was Amadou & Mariam's breakthrough international album, following their previous work which had gained limited recognition outside Mali. This album marked a significant moment in their career as they collaborated with French producer Manu Chao, elevating their sound and visibility on the world stage.
